Warm up with this sweet treat that tastes of the tropics.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ees. In a food processor, pulse ginger until finely chopped. Add brown sugar, allspice, and bread. Pulse until coarse crumbs form.
- Sprinkle 1/2 cup of crumb mixture in the bottom of an 8-inch square (2-quart) baking dish; fill with mangoes, and drizzle with lemon juice. Level fruit with the back of a spoon.
- Top with remaining crumb mixture; dot with butter. Bake until crumbs are golden brown and fruit is bubbly, about 45 minutes. Serve.
